Research Overview:
My original research appointment (in 1985) was as an animal growth biologist/cell biologist, with an emphasis on skeletal muscle (tissue) growth and development. My present research interests are: regulation of mature fat cell dedifferentiation in beef cattle and pigs, regulation of myogenic satellite cell proliferation and differentiation, and the intercellular communication between muscle and fat cells. Application of knowledge gained by my laboratory will lead to new procedures to regulate carcass composition in domestic (meat) animals, alleviate problems associated with obesity, provide new cells for tissue engineering applications, and help counteract dysfunctions such as diabetes.
